Posts tagged ‘seo’

http://www.itbadu.com/seo/gjcpmcxgj.html#comment 这个是介绍工具的

http://www.flashplayer.cn/keywords/  这是下载地址

url中,#号之后的部分被认为是锚点,仅用于页面定位,而不被视为url的有效成分。

一般浏览器,都不会将#号后的部分发送给web服务器,所以web服务器的log的request part中,一般不含有#。但是,当某些应用程序,直接发送含有#号的url时,web服务器(至少apache)会忠实的记录下来,这时,在log里你就会发现#号了。

从SEO的角度来看,google、baidu是会忽略#号和它之后的成分的。

以google的一个帮助页面为例:

http://www.google.com/intl/zh-CN/help/features.html#local

http://www.google.com/intl/zh-CN/help/features.html#essentials

以上两个完整的url都没有被“收录”,而http://www.google.com/intl/zh-CN/help/features.html是被收录的。

据说,现在包含#号的url,在flash、ajax、html5中的应用比较多,因为这样可以不刷新浏览器,而由程序控制,向后台请求数据,重绘页面。从而保证较好的用户体验。

ps:本文由MySpace.cn的音乐新产品Play触发。该页面的url组成为:http://music.myspace.cn/play/#/1300348224

SEOmoz推出了一个新的免费SEO工具:http://www.seomoz.org/labs/lda。它可以利用LDA模型,计算指定关键词与页面内容之间的相关性。其页面上称,该模型是根据8 million个文档训练而成的。可惜的是,目前貌似不支持中文,而且不知道该模型对baidu这样的搜索引擎是否有效。

但是这个想法很新颖,几乎可以改变我认为SEO缺乏技术含量的观点。

其原文《Content Optimization: Revisiting Topic Modeling, LDA & Our Labs Tool》中包含对SEOmoz的CEO的采访视频,其中有一帧给出了在google搜索“seo”,前几名的各项评分:

在google中搜索seo

在google中搜索seo

在《深入理解搜索引擎》一书中,也提到过,搜索引擎的大致流程是爬取网页,过滤,反向索引,压缩存储,根据用户的输入关键词进行查找,打分。而在打分的环节,会考虑到的有关键词匹配度、位置、TD/IDF等。既然会这么复杂,那么单纯的考量关键词密度(很多seo工具都可以查看),或者根据经验模拟决策树在合适的位置放置合适的关键词,肯定是不够的。

SEOmoz提出的LDA模型,或者今后我们会发现有其他更合适的模型,能够模拟搜索引擎评分的机制,无疑会大大的增加SEO的有效性。

附:SEOmoz给出的页面优化建议,老生常谈,但很详细:Perfecting Keyword Targeting & On-Page Optimization

wiki中的LDA介绍:Latent Dirichlet allocation

前些天,为公司的音乐频道添加了一个sitemap页面:MySpace音乐人地图

其间过程如下:

1、做了一个很大的页面,把所有音乐人的链接都放进去了,页面大约3M以上,而且url是动态的。结果很久未收录。

2、进行页面切分,将音乐人地图区分为主页和内容页。其中,主页地址为:http://music.myspace.cn/sitemap/ ,内容页为 http://music.myspace.cn/sitemap/A 等。

5月27日sitemap页面上线,到6月3日,被收录,baidu快照时间是2010-5-27。

在此期间,sitemap.xml中并没有添加该地址。仅是在MySpace音乐频道的底部添加了指向http://music.myspace.cn/sitemap/的链接。

现在,即6月3日,将sitemap主页以及内容页都加入到sitemap.xml中。

另外,一般情况下,应该保证一个页面仅有一个uri,即http://music.myspace.cn/sitemap 与 http://music.myspace.cn/sitemap/、http://music.myspace.cn/sitemap/index.html 如果都指向一个页面,那么应该统一起来,使其他url都301跳转到该url上。

通过dispatch里一些简单的字符串处理就可以做到:

if (preg_match(‘#\.php/?$#’, $uri) > 0){
$uri = preg_replace(‘#\.php/?$#’, ”, $_SERVER[‘SCRIPT_URI’]) . ‘/';
header(“Location: “. $uri, true, 301);
exit;
}
if (substr($uri, -1) != ‘/’){
header(“Location: “.$_SERVER[‘SCRIPT_URI’] . ‘/’, true, 301);
exit;
}

Site指令,往往是很多SEO在查询网站收录数量时经常运用到的。其实Site的作用不仅仅体现在查询网站收录数量。它同时还具备很多的作用,例如网页优化时,选择哪个网页进行排名。以及整站优化时如何使用Site指令查看网站结构缺陷。除了可以用在分析网站之外,它也可以用做更好更合理的选取长尾关键字,来增进搜索引擎营销效果。掌握好Site指令的用法,也可以说是学习网络营销中的一个重要的过程。下面是Zeaer罗列出Site指令的运用技巧。

在SEO搜索引擎优化中,Site的重要用途
1) 可以用做查询网站搜索引擎收录数量。
其实这个方法大多数有互联网工作经验的人士都是知道的,就是利用site:wlyx.org(网站域名),通过针对的搜索引擎搜索,就可以轻松的查询出网站在该搜索引擎中的收录数量。当然,你也可以通过该指令来分析SEO竞争对手的网站情况。

2) 可以用来挑选好的反向链接
这个方法相对上面而言,经常运用的人就要少了很多。这其实也是一个搜索引擎的Bug,例如我要寻找的网站反向链接为公益性质的、并且与我网站相关的。我可以这样来寻找,在搜索引擎中输入指令“site:org 网络营销”,再或者输入指令“site:org.cn  营销”等等,当然如果是公司性质的站点可以输入指令“site:com.cn 营销”。利用这种方式所挑选出排在前面的大多是一些相对来说高质量的站点。

如果是需要发布博客链接的时候,挑选高权重域名下的资源博客,就更简单了。只要输入指令“site:gov.cn 博客”里面也有很多博客是允许注册以及添加链接的。这个主要是领用搜索引擎的Bug缺陷来实现的,往往很多SEO从业者都没有注意到。

3) 整站优化中也可Site指令用来分析网站的权重分布
以我的博客为例,我可以在Google搜索引擎中输入“site:wlyx.org”往往排在前面的都是权重相对较高的网页,一般情况下好的网站都是按照顺序排列的,例如一级页面,随后是二级页面…

4) 网页优化中可以更好更快的选出需要优化的网页
例如我要为一个网站做一个关键字,使他在百度排名前列。我可以通过百度搜索指令“site:域名 关键字”来判断出该站点目前最有排名优势的页面。

Site在搜索引擎营销中的作用
可以用来更好更直观的选择长尾关键字,来促进网站的网络销售效果。
例如我可以到一些论坛,或者天涯问吧,百度知道之类的问答网站,在当中寻找与行业相关的问题,当然一个个去找固然麻烦,我可以利用“site:zhidao.baidu.com 行业主要关键字”直接进行寻找,所出来的结果往往都是网友们需要解决的问题或者经常被搜索的相关长尾关键字。长尾关键字与搜索引擎营销有着密不可分的关系,因此只要掌握了这些方法,可以更好的促进企业的网络营销业绩。

由于时间的关系,仅罗列出一条,为读者提供参考。其实Site的用途还有很多,需要大家自己去思考,去发现。

2009年8月13日更正
原先文章中的site中S字母使用了大写,现已进行更正。注意使用site指令时,需要保证字母为小写。

本文出自:泽雅营销日志
原文链接:(http://wlyx.org/search-engine-optimization/basic-technology/site-instruction)

拒绝所有以Admin5为首的站长网转载 | 正规网站转载时请保留版权文字以及正规链接